Estimating Market Size
Two methods work well:
- Top-down: Start with an industry’s total value. Apply realistic adoption rates.
- Bottom-up: Count potential customers. Multiply by your product price.
Use industry reports and credible sources. For example, if your app targets UK SMEs, find data on SME spending in your niche. Show a five-year outlook. A forecast at 5-10% annual growth is believable for many tech sectors.
Mapping Competitors
List 5–8 rivals. Describe their strengths and weaknesses. For each one:
- Name and website
- Core services
- Unique selling points
Highlight gaps you will fill. Maybe you offer deeper AI evaluation or faster turnaround. Combining that gap insight with financial targets makes your plan memorable.
Building Solid Revenue Projection Models
Now you have market data. Time to turn it into revenue projections. You need clear, defensible assumptions. Here’s how:
Choose Your Forecast Approach
• Driver-based: Link growth drivers like user volume, transaction value, pricing tiers.
• Historical trend: If you have past revenue, extend that with realistic growth rates.
• Hybrid: Blend driver assumptions with trend analysis.
A technology giant like Visa has revenue forecasts around 9.6% per annum. Use that as context. Your startup may grow faster early on, then taper. Show that shift.
Layer in Pricing and Adoption
Break your forecast into phases:
- Pilot: Small cohort, limited features, 10–15 customers.
- Growth: Wider rollout, marketing pushes, 50–100 customers.
- Scale: Full launch, channel partnerships, hundreds of users.
Set prices for each phase. Calculate monthly or quarterly revenue. Sum up to an annual figure. Then show how that ramps over three to five years.

Cash Flow Forecasts and Break-even Analysis
Your revenue forecast is just part of the story. Cash flow shows you can fund operations until profit.
Build a Cash Flow Statement
Include:
- Inflows: customer payments, grants, pre-seed funding
- Outflows: salaries, rent, marketing, software licences
- Timing: month-by-month projections for at least 12–24 months
Calculate Break-even
Identify when cumulative inflow equals cumulative outflow. A clear break-even date proves viability. Many Innovator Visa panels like to see break-even within two to three years. If yours is sooner, even better.
Show Cash Runway
Include funding rounds and reserves. If you raise £200k and burn £20k per month, that’s 10 months of runway. Make sure you explain follow-on funding or revenue streams that extend the runway beyond the Innovator Visa’s initial period.

Common Pitfalls in Financial Forecasting (and How to Avoid Them)
You will see mistakes often. Avoid these:
- Over-optimistic growth rates.
- Missing operating costs.
- Ignoring seasonality or market cycles.
- Using inconsistent units (monthly vs annual).
- Failing to justify assumptions with data.
Keep forecasts simple. Back every number with a note or footnote. That shows rigour.
